Default RE: Winners Choice Cable Slide

I've been using the Weather Tamer (WC) on my Allegiance for a while now WITHOUT any problems and have absolutely no problems with vane clearance. The cable groove design lets the buss cable move naturally, producing less drag and more consistency. The ROUNDED radiuses provides excellent resistance to cable wear--so I find it IMPOSSIBLE to see how this cable slide can destroy cables!!!
Added to the machined aluminum the WC now also comes in a machined delrin.

Default RE: Winners Choice Cable Slide

It is way easier on cables, the openings are much wider and the machining has larger radius's on the edges. They preserve the X-coat on the winnerscoice way better than the factory hoyts or the unique teflon slides, at least the one I bought last year has. the only difference between last years and this yearsis that they rotated their logo 90 degrees.
